For the weekly sync: the nightly reindex job for Quillbase search has exceeded its four-hour window three times this week. The alert fires when the indexer is still running at 06:00, which risks overlapping with the morning snapshot job and serving stale results to early users. Root cause appears to be growth in the attachments corpus after the Larkfield migration. No user-facing impact yet, but the margin is shrinking. Current runbook steps, timing charts, and the proposed sharding plan are on the internal page here.

operations page: https://jenkins.zemvarcloud.local/job/merge_requests/repo/build/73930b4b30f0a8ed

Ticket: Training Video Studio — Room 3.12, Ashgate Wharf

The studio is now ready for new-starter recording sessions. Bookings go through the internal calendar; sessions capped at two hours. Leave the lighting rig settings as found and power down the capture deck after use. The door has been rekeyed following last month's fit-out, so the new entry code applies, as follows.

staff pass of kawip-hawef = bdg-QLP-2

Visitor policy — Marlowe Point, front desk

All contractors report to the front desk on arrival. Sign in, present photo ID, and wait for your site sponsor. No unescorted movement beyond the lobby. Hi-vis and boots required past the atrium doors. Lost passes must be reported immediately to the desk. Contractors cleared for the service corridor will be issued the following door-pass code:

door code, yagap-bahof: bdg-O-05

Handover note — Crumbwheel order cutoffs.

Welcome aboard. The bakery cutoff rule in Crumbwheel closes same-day orders at 14:00 local to each storefront, not UTC — this has bitten us twice. Holiday overrides live in the calendar service and take precedence silently, so always check there first when a cutoff looks wrong. To unlock the calendar service's admin console after a restart, enter the recovery passphrase below.

vault phrase of bagap-bahaf = silion-pelox-sorox-casdor-quenwyn-fraax-eliox-praael-kelion-quenvan-kasox-rusael-norius-belvan